The Wrigley Building, an iconic architectural marvel in Chicago, offers tourists a glimpse into the city's rich history and stunning design. This historic structure, known for its unique terracotta façade and clock tower, is a must-visit for anyone exploring the vibrant downtown area. Situated along the picturesque Michigan Avenue, it serves as a perfect backdrop for photos and leisurely strolls along the river. The building houses a variety of shops and dining options, making it an excellent stop during your Chicago adventure.
